A Bachelor's Degree is an undergraduate academic degree awarded by universities and colleges upon completion of a specific course of study. It typically takes around 3-4 years to complete and provides students with a solid foundation in a particular field of study, preparing them for entry-level positions or further education at the Master's level.
Statistics is the study of collecting, analyzing, interpreting, presenting, and organizing data. It plays a crucial role in various fields such as business, healthcare, social sciences, and more. Statisticians use mathematical techniques to make informed decisions, predict trends, and solve real-world problems based on data-driven insights.
